"Employees for Night Intake"
The AWO District Association Berlin-Mitte e. V.

is one of the largest providers of social work in Berlin, with currently around 450 employees in over 40 facilities.

We are currently seeking employees for the nightly intake of women* who are affected or threatened by acute domestic violence, as well as their children.


This is initially a fixed-term position until December 31, 2023, with a weekly working time of 20 hours, exclusively during the night shift from 10:30 pm to 8:00 am.

We aim to make these positions permanent.


The low-threshold "night intake" complements the accessibility and qualified counseling provided by the "BIG Hotline" during the day for women* who are affected by acute domestic violence and seeking refuge in a women's* shelter.

The women* and their children are primarily admitted to the existing AWO women's* shelter in Berlin-Mitte. The BIG e.
V. clearing center is also located in the second AWO women's* shelter in Berlin-Mitte.


For conceptual reasons, this position can only be filled by women.

Job Description:


  • Receiving calls and assessing the current (counseling) needs of the callers
  • Lowthreshold clarification of the situation through targeted questioning (current location, situation of the children, if necessary, contacting the police/ambulance in case of danger to life and limb) including current risk assessment
